MySQL資料庫設定root密碼
阿新 • • 發佈:2018-12-09
mysqladmin
- root未設定過密碼
格式:mysqladmin -uroot password 密碼 例子:mysqladmin -uroot password 123root已設定過密碼 格式:mysqladmin -u使用者名稱 -p舊密碼 password 新密碼 例子:mysqladmin -uroot -p123456 password 123
set password
首先登入MySQL。
格式:mysql> set password for 使用者名稱@localhost = password(‘新密碼’); 例子:mysql> set password for
[email protected] = password(‘123’);
update mysql下的user表
首先登入MySQL。
mysql> use mysql; mysql> update user set password=password(‘123’) where user=’root’ and host=’localhost’; mysql> flush privileges;
忘記root密碼時
mysqld_safe –skip-grant-tables& mysql -u root mysql mysql> update user set password=password(“新密碼”) where user=’root’; mysql> flush privileges;